Vice President - Dealer Sales
Generac Power Systems
**We are Generac, a leading energy technology company committed to powering a smarter world.**
Over the 60 plus years of Generac’s history, we’ve been dedicated to energy innovation. From creating the home standby generator market category, to our current evolution into an energy technology solutions company, we continue to push new boundaries.
The VP Residential Dealer Sales is responsible for leading and directing the sales team to achieve short and long-range strategic objectives through successful planning and execution of sales strategies for the Residential Dealer Sales Channel. The VP Sales is responsible for the entire range of sales planning and development, sales promotion, and sales activities. The role will work closely with other departments, such as marketing and product development, to ensure alignment with company goals and objectives. The VP Sales will also drive market input back to the organization to improve positioning with programs, product development, and end user support to Generac customers across energy technology products and solutions. In addition, this role will provide strategic direction to the broader Dealer Sales team in support of new product and service introduction for our dealer network to integrate into their business model. This role requires a blend of strategic thinking, leadership, and operation expertise to oversee sales growth, strategies, and performance.
**Major Responsibilities**
**30%:** Sales Strategy Development and Execution - Develop and implement the overall sales strategy to meet revenue targets, increase gross profit, and expand market share. Align sales strategies with company objectives and market dynamics, adjusting as necessary to maintain competitiveness. Provide strategic direction and education to the field sales organization and dealer partners related to new, integrated products and services. Monitor and report on dealer adoption or “uptake” rate. Analyze market trends, customer and end consumer needs, and competitor activities to refine sales approaches. Stay abreast of industry trends, new technologies, and competitive landscapes. Build and maintain strong relationships with key customers, clients, and partners. Engage in high-level negotiations and close national sales agreements to ensure long-term business success.
**30%:** Revenue Growth and Profitability - Identify new sales opportunities and target markets to drive revenue growth. Oversee the development and execution of sales forecasts and budgets. Implement effective sales processes and methodologies to maximize profitability. Develop annual sales budgets and forecasts, ensuring alignment with financial goals. Monitor sales expenses to ensure cost-effectiveness and maximize return on investment.
**20%:** Cross-Functional Collaboration - Work closely with marketing, product, and operations teams to ensure a unified approach to market penetration and customer acquisition. Provide feedback to product teams on customer preferences and market trends to inform product development.
**20%:** Leadership and Team Management - Lead, mentor, and manage a high performing sales team, including sales directors, managers, and individual contributors. Establish clear goals and KPIs for the sales team, ensuring performance is aligned with company expectations. Provide coaching and training to enhance team capabilities and foster a collaborative, results-driven culture. Monitor and evaluate sales performance metrics and implement corrective actions when necessary. Use CRM tools and analytics to track sales pipeline, conversion rates, and team performance. Provide regular reports to executive leadership on sales performance, challenges, and opportunities.
